Market Overview

The Global Battery Monitoring System Market will grow from USD 7.78 Billion in 2025 to USD 20.17 Billion by 2031 at a 17.21% CAGR. A Battery Monitoring System is an electronic control unit designed to oversee the operational state of rechargeable battery packs by regulating parameters such as voltage, temperature, and current to ensure safety and optimal performance. The primary drivers supporting the growth of this market include the rapid acceleration of electric vehicle adoption and the increasing integration of renewable energy storage grids which require precise management to prevent failure. According to the International Energy Agency, in 2024, annual global battery demand surpassed the 1 terawatt-hour mark for the first time, a milestone that directly correlates with the rising necessity for advanced monitoring solutions to manage this vast deployed capacity.

Despite the robust expansion of the sector, a significant challenge impeding broader market scalability is the lack of uniform standardization across battery architectures and communication protocols. This fragmentation forces manufacturers to develop high-cost custom solutions for different battery chemistries and applications rather than universal products. Such technical complexity increases research and development expenses and complicates the integration process for end users, potentially slowing the widespread adoption of third-party monitoring systems across diverse industrial sectors.

Key Market Drivers

The accelerated global adoption of electric and hybrid vehicles acts as a primary catalyst for the battery monitoring system market. As automotive manufacturers transition toward electrification, the demand for precise electronic control units to manage lithium-ion packs has intensified. These systems are essential for maintaining cell balance, preventing thermal runaway, and accurately estimating range, which directly impacts consumer confidence. According to the International Energy Agency, April 2024, in the 'Global EV Outlook 2024', electric car sales are projected to reach approximately 17 million in 2024, representing a robust increase that necessitates scalable monitoring solutions. This volume of vehicular deployment compels suppliers to innovate faster communication protocols to meet the rigorous performance standards of modern transport fleets.

Simultaneously, the rapid expansion of renewable energy integration and grid storage drives dependency on sophisticated oversight technologies. Utility providers utilize large-scale battery arrays to stabilize grids, requiring constant surveillance to optimize charge cycles and prolong asset lifespan. According to the U.S. Energy Information Administration, February 2024, in the 'Preliminary Monthly Electric Generator Inventory', U.S. battery storage capacity is expected to nearly double to roughly 31 gigawatts in 2024. This surge in infrastructure relies on automated monitoring to ensure reliability. Furthermore, the financial scale of this sector underscores the critical role of protection systems. According to the International Energy Agency, in 2024, global investment in battery storage is set to exceed USD 40 billion, emphasizing the value of assets that require the assurance provided by advanced battery monitoring architectures.

Key Market Challenges

The lack of uniform standardization across battery architectures and communication protocols presents a substantial barrier to the scalability of the Global Battery Monitoring System Market. Because battery manufacturers utilize diverse chemistries and proprietary structural designs, monitoring system providers are unable to rely on a universal engineering approach. Instead, they are frequently compelled to allocate significant resources toward developing bespoke configurations for each unique application. This requirement for customization extends development timelines and prevents the industry from achieving the economies of scale necessary to reduce unit costs, thereby limiting the addressable market for third-party solutions.

This technical fragmentation creates a financial disparity that becomes increasingly problematic as battery hardware costs decline. According to the International Energy Agency, in 2024, the average price of a battery pack for a battery electric car dropped below USD 100 per kilowatt-hour. As the fundamental storage hardware becomes more affordable, the persistent high costs associated with engineering non-standardized monitoring units account for a larger proportion of the total system expense. Consequently, this economic friction discourages potential adopters in cost-sensitive industrial sectors, effectively dampening the overall growth trajectory of the monitoring system market.

Key Market Trends

The Integration of Artificial Intelligence and Machine Learning Algorithms is transitioning battery management from reactive monitoring to predictive oversight. Manufacturers are embedding logic that analyzes real-time inputs to identify degradation patterns before failures occur, enhancing safety. This shift enables precise state-of-health estimations that exceed the capabilities of traditional rule-based controllers. According to LG Energy Solution, September 2024, in the press release 'LG Energy Solution Launches New Brand B.around for Battery Management Total Solution', their newly developed AI-powered management software has secured a safety detection accuracy rate of over 90%, validating the operational impact of these algorithmic capabilities.

Simultaneously, the Advancement of Vehicle-to-Grid (V2G) Integration Capabilities requires systems to evolve into bidirectional controllers capable of synchronizing with utility networks. As vehicles act as mobile storage, architectures must manage the stress of frequent charge-discharge cycles for grid stabilization while preserving propulsion viability. This necessitates robust durability standards to support dual operational demands. According to the Sino-German Energy Partnership, January 2024, in the article 'New Policy Supports the Integration of new Energy Vehicles into the Power Grid', China's National Development and Reform Commission released guidelines requiring V2G-compliant battery technologies to achieve a lifespan of 3,000 cycles or more, establishing strict technical benchmarks for this trend.

Segmental Insights

Based on insights from trusted market research, the Wired Battery Monitoring System segment is identified as the fastest-growing category within the global market, primarily driven by the surging adoption of Electric Vehicles (EVs) and the critical expansion of Data Center infrastructure. Wired configurations, such as CAN bus systems, remain the industry standard for automotive applications due to their superior reliability, stability, and immunity to electromagnetic interference—qualities essential for ensuring passenger safety and operational continuity in high-voltage environments. Consequently, the rapid proliferation of the EV sector directly accelerates the demand for robust wired monitoring solutions over wireless alternatives in these mission-critical applications.

Regional Insights

North America maintains a leading position in the global battery monitoring system market due to the widespread integration of electric vehicles and renewable energy infrastructure. The dominance of the region is reinforced by strict regulatory mandates that prioritize grid stability and operational safety. For example, standards set by the North American Electric Reliability Corporation require utility providers to implement rigorous battery maintenance and monitoring protocols. These compliance requirements, coupled with substantial investments in the telecommunications and data center sectors, drive the consistent demand for effective battery management solutions throughout the United States and Canada.

Recent Developments

  • In December 2024, Marelli announced a significant advancement in automotive battery management systems (BMS) by introducing a solution based on Electrochemical Impedance Spectroscopy (EIS). Unveiled at an industry symposium in Berlin, this technology was developed to monitor the state of battery cells more effectively by analyzing internal battery dynamics such as degradation and resistance changes. Unlike traditional laboratory-based EIS methods, Marelli’s cost-effective design was engineered for large-scale production and aimed to prevent thermal runaway through early anomaly detection. The system facilitated real-time estimation of the battery's state of charge and power, thereby optimizing the performance and safety of electric vehicle battery packs.
  • In December 2024, Infineon Technologies signed a memorandum of understanding with EVE Energy Co. to collaborate on the development of advanced battery management system (BMS) solutions for the automotive market. Under this agreement, Infineon committed to supplying a comprehensive chipset comprising microcontroller units, balancing and monitoring integrated circuits, and power management components. The partnership aimed to enhance the safety, reliability, and cost-efficiency of battery systems used in electric vehicles. By integrating these semiconductor solutions, the collaboration focused on delivering more accurate battery monitoring and protection, which contributed to improved energy efficiency and optimized driving performance for next-generation automotive applications.
  • In November 2024, NXP Semiconductors unveiled an industry-first wireless battery management system (BMS) solution incorporating Ultra-Wideband (UWB) technology. This innovative system was designed to overcome development challenges such as complex manufacturing processes and high costs associated with traditional wired architectures. By utilizing wireless communication within the battery pack, the solution eliminated the need for intricate wiring harnesses, thereby simplifying assembly and enabling increased battery energy density. The technology offered robust data transfer resistance to reflections and fading, ensuring reliable voltage and temperature measurements. NXP indicated that this development would provide manufacturers with greater flexibility and faster time-to-market for electric vehicles.
  • In June 2024, Eatron Technologies and Syntiant announced a collaboration to introduce an AI-powered battery management system (BMS) on a chip. This new solution integrated Eatron’s intelligent software layer with Syntiant’s ultra-low-power Neural Decision Processor to process data at the edge. The companies claimed that this breakthrough technology could unlock an additional 10% of battery capacity and extend battery lifespan by up to 25% compared to traditional systems. Designed for a wide range of applications including light mobility, industrial equipment, and consumer electronics, the turnkey solution aimed to deliver precise state-of-health and state-of-charge estimations while detecting potential issues early through predictive diagnostics.
